Reference and General Information Cannot eject the removable drive. • The connection with the CF card or other removable media could not be terminated. Exit XF Utility and use the Windows Safely Remove Hardware function to disconnect the hardware and only then restart XF Utility. • The connection with the external hard disk or other removable mass storage device could not be terminated. Exit XF Utility and use the Windows Safely Remove Hardware function to disconnect the device and only then restart XF Utility. Cannot export the MXF files. • Check the access privileges of the user account you are using. 37 Cannot move the clips. • The clips could not be moved to the selected media. Check the target media. Cannot move the clips because the number of clips in the target media will exceed 999. • The maximum number of clips in a media is 999 clips. Reduce the number of clips to move or select a different target media. Cannot read the clips. • The clip's information file or stream file is corrupt or damaged. Use a backup copy of the clip, if you have one. Cannot rename the virtual media. • Check the local folder on the computer where the virtual media was saved. Cannot save. • The User Memo file could not be saved because the SD memory card is write-protected. Cannot save the clip properties. • Check the media that contains the selected clips. Cannot save the file. A memory card can store up to 100 user memo files. • The maximum number of User Memo files on a single SD memory card is 100 files. Delete any unnecessary User Memo files or save the file on a different memory card. Canon XF MPEG2 Decoder is not installed • Reinstall the software using the Canon XF Utilities CD-ROM. For details refer to the camcorder's Instruction Manual. Corrupt or damaged clip. Cannot add shot marks. // Cannot complete the operation. // Cannot delete custom picture files. // Cannot save the clip properties. // Cannot set the thumbnail picture. • Check the media that contains the selected clips. Folder for backup files not found. • Check the local folder on the computer designated as the backup folder. Memory card is not detected. • The SD memory card was removed while you were editing a User Memo profile. Always close the Manage User Memo Profiles dialog box before removing he SD memory card. NTSC clips and PAL clips cannot be stored in the same media. • Replace the CF card. The path of the folder for backup files is incorrect. • Check the local folder on the computer designated as the backup folder. The selected frame could not be saved as the thumbnail picture. • Check the media that contains the selected clips. The user memo file is corrupted or damaged. • Check the SD memory card or the local folder on the computer where the User Memo file is saved. • Use a different User Memo file or create and save a new User Memo file. Unable create the folder. The folder already exists. • A local folder with same name already exists on the computer. Check the local folder on the computer where you wanted to create the virtual media.
